My Personal Ethic Codes


            For me, personal ethic is really important because it reflects my personal moral principles, what I believe in order to help me to decide what is right or wrong in life. Ethic also shapes the way I behave towards other people to succeed. Therefore, for me, developing a personal ethic code plays an important part in my life because it helps me to know how to distinguish between right and wrong, how to react to many different situations, and how to be myself. For me, ethics are who I am, and what makes me like this. I had a hard time struggling with the decision of what I desired to be, but I am pretty sure about who I am and what I choose as my ethic code. .
             I believe that I was being taught ethics when I was still a fetus. My mother told me she usually read moral stories when she was pregnant. She believed that I could hear and understood even when I was still in her womb. Then, I was growing up, influenced by my mother's moral stories and the way my mother and my father behaved towards others in life. Moreover, they always told me to respect and care about others by showing me the value of caring and love. "Kindness and love always make you happy and succeed in life" was an advice that I mostly heard from them when I was young. As a result, at that time, my personal code of ethics is being respectful and caring about others as my parents' belief. Then, I went to school, meeting other people, remembering my parents' advice, I always reminded me to treat people I met with respect and love. For example, I tried to listen my friends' problems, and tried to help them to overcome theirs. I also treated them with kindness and respect. I was always thinking about others' thought while talking with them in order to understand them. That might be a reason why I rarely had an argument or conflict with any person when I was young. Actually, whenever I had any different point of view with my friend, I always tried to put me in their positions in order to understand their thoughts, finding the common things between us and then came up with an agreement.
